A two-double bedroom terrace house, with extended kitchen and driveway parking, situated in A popular north feltham location, offered to the market with no onward chain.
Double glazed entrance door: To;
hall: Stairs to first floor, door to;
living room: 20.5 x 10.8 (6.22 x 3.25m), Double glazed bay window, radiator, doors to;
cloakroom: Low level W.C., wash hand basin, understairs storage cupboard.
Kitchen: 14 x 10.7 (4.27 x 3.2379m), Double glazed windows and stable door to garden, modern range of base and eye level units, laminated worksurfaces, stainless steel one and a half bowl sink and drainer, gas four ring hob with extractor over, integral fridge and freezer, dishwasher, electric oven and grill, space for washing machine, tiled splashback.
First floor landing: Doors to;
bedroom 1: 10.8 x 10.2 (6.22 x 3.1m), Double glazed window, radiator.
Bedroom 2: 10.1 x 7.8 (3.07 x 2.34m), Double glazed window, radiator.
Shower room: Double glazed frosted window, shower cubicle, low-level W.C., vanity wash hand basin, heated towel rail, fully tiled, loft hatch.
Outside
Driveway: Block paved, parking for two cars.
Rear garden: Patioed, enclosed by wood fencing.
Garage: 19.7 x 15 (5.97 x 4.57m), Double doors, light and power.
